“Next is depressants. Depressants are drugs


called downers, sedatives, and tranquilizers.
These drugs slow down mental processes. These
are the opposite of stimulants. The examples are
barbiturates and sedatives, which are prescribed
to people with insomnia, epilepsy, and nervous
breakdown, to induce sleep, and to allow the
nerves to relax. Like stimulants, depressants
could have bad effects in our health when
abused. The guidance of a physician is needed
when depressants are used.
Class always keep in mind that alcohol is also a
depressants.”

“Next we have the Hallucinogens” Hallucinogens


or psychedelics are drugs that affects sensation,
thinking, and emotions. They produce illusions
and hallucinations, provoke the imaginations,
and disturb person’s thinking. Examples of this
drug is marijuana. These drugs are of little help
in field of medicine.”
